Selling a business isn't just about timing the market. It's about knowing yourself.
In this episode of Rogue Startups, Craig Hewitt sits down with Colin Gray, founder of Alitu and The Podcast Host, to discuss what it's really like to sell a SaaS company after 15 years. Colin shares why he decided to exit, how founders should think about timing a sale, the emotional side of letting go of a business, and why "stair-stepping" through multiple businesses may be a smarter path than chasing a single life-changing exit. They also explore how AI is reshaping SaaS, content marketing, and YouTube, as well as what comes next after selling a company you've spent years building.
Whether you're thinking about selling a business someday or simply trying to build one that lasts, this conversation is packed with honest advice from two experienced bootstrapped founders.
